很多人在第一次接触云计算时,都会被一个问题绕进去:阿里云是iaas还是paas?表面看,这像是一个非黑即白的选择题,但只要真正上手过阿里云的产品,答案就不会这么简单。因为阿里云并不是单一形态的云服务,而是一个覆盖基础设施、平台能力、数据库、中间件、大数据、人工智能乃至行业解决方案的完整生态。换句话说,如果非要用一句话回答,那么更准确的说法是:阿里云既提供IaaS,也提供PaaS,而且在很多场景中两者是协同出现的。

之所以会有争议,是因为很多企业最先接触阿里云时,使用的是云服务器ECS、对象存储OSS、负载均衡SLB这类产品。这些服务给人的直观感受就是“租服务器、租网络、租存储”,因此不少人会自然得出结论:阿里云就是IaaS。可当企业进一步使用RDS、容器服务ACK、函数计算、消息队列、数据湖分析等产品时,又会发现阿里云显然不只是提供底层资源,它还在向上封装能力,帮助用户减少运维、开发和架构负担,这就是典型的PaaS特征。
IaaS和PaaS到底怎么区分
在判断阿里云是iaas还是paas之前,先要搞明白IaaS和PaaS的边界。IaaS,也就是基础设施即服务,核心是把原本需要企业自己采购和管理的计算、存储、网络资源,变成可弹性购买、按量使用的云资源。用户通常仍然需要关心操作系统、运行环境、应用部署、扩缩容策略以及很多底层运维工作。典型的IaaS产品就是云服务器、云硬盘、专有网络、弹性公网IP等。
PaaS,也就是平台即服务,往上再走一层。平台方不只是给你一台虚拟机,而是直接提供开发、部署、运行应用所需的平台能力。用户不必过多管理操作系统和中间件,可以更专注于业务逻辑本身。比如托管数据库、容器平台、Serverless服务、应用运行环境、消息中间件等,通常都属于PaaS范畴。
如果把云计算比作开餐厅,IaaS更像是给你一个可租赁的场地和水电燃气,你还要自己买设备、请厨师、定流程;PaaS则更像是已经搭好的标准化中央厨房,你只需要基于现成平台去做菜和出品。这个比喻虽然简化了概念,但足以帮助很多非技术背景的管理者快速理解区别。
从阿里云产品线看,它显然不止一种形态
先看IaaS层。阿里云的ECS云服务器、块存储、OSS对象存储、VPC专有网络、NAT网关、负载均衡、CDN等,都是非常典型的基础设施服务。企业可以像搭积木一样自己配置CPU、内存、带宽、磁盘、镜像和安全策略。这一层的灵活性极高,适合有自主运维能力、需要精细控制环境的企业。比如一家传统软件公司把原来的本地机房迁移上云,往往最先使用的就是这一层能力。
再看PaaS层,阿里云的能力同样丰富。以RDS为例,企业无需自己搭建MySQL、维护主从架构、处理备份、监控和高可用,平台已经把很多复杂操作封装好;再比如ACK容器服务,虽然底层依然离不开计算和网络资源,但平台已经帮助用户管理Kubernetes集群的大量复杂工作;函数计算则更明显,开发者甚至不必关心服务器实例,只需要写代码、配置触发器,系统就会自动执行和扩缩容。这些都不是传统IaaS能完全覆盖的事情。
因此,如果有人简单地问阿里云是iaas还是paas,最容易出现误判的原因就是只看到了其中一层。事实上,阿里云作为综合云厂商,其产品矩阵天然就是分层的。它既出售“毛坯房”,也提供“精装房”,甚至还可以给你“拎包入住”的行业级解决方案。
实测场景一:自己搭网站,阿里云更像IaaS
为了让这个问题更直观,我们可以从实际使用场景来判断。假设你要搭建一个企业官网或内容站,最简单的方式通常是购买一台ECS云服务器,配置Linux系统,再安装Nginx、PHP、MySQL或其他运行环境。这个过程中,你需要自己处理服务器初始化、安全组、端口开放、环境部署、日志管理、性能优化和数据备份。即便阿里云提供了一些镜像市场和运维工具,本质上你仍然是在使用底层资源,平台并没有替你屏蔽太多复杂性。
在这个案例中,阿里云呈现出的主要能力就是IaaS。你买到的是计算、网络和存储,至于软件栈怎么搭、应用怎么跑、故障怎么排查,主要责任还在自己手里。对于技术团队较强的公司来说,这种方式自由度高、可控性强;但对于中小企业或者个人开发者来说,也意味着更高的维护成本。
实测场景二:直接上托管数据库,阿里云明显带有PaaS属性
再换一个更常见的业务需求。很多企业把应用部署在ECS上,但数据库并不自己装,而是直接购买阿里云RDS。为什么?因为数据库看似只是一个软件,真正稳定运行起来却很考验经验:参数调优、主备切换、定时备份、磁盘扩容、监控告警、版本升级、异常恢复,每一步都可能影响业务连续性。
使用RDS后,这些工作中的很大一部分由平台代为完成。企业不需要从零搭建数据库架构,也不需要每天盯着备份任务是否正常。对于业务团队而言,他们接触到的是一个“可直接使用的数据库能力”,而不是一台安装了数据库软件的裸服务器。从服务边界看,这就是典型的PaaS化交付。
这也说明,讨论阿里云是iaas还是paas时,不能脱离具体产品。阿里云的ECS偏IaaS,RDS偏PaaS,函数计算则更接近Serverless形态,已经比传统PaaS又往前走了一步。
实测场景三:容器与Serverless,让边界更模糊
云计算发展到今天,单纯讨论IaaS和PaaS,已经不足以覆盖所有产品形态。以阿里云ACK为例,用户确实仍然能看到节点、网络、存储等基础资源,但大量集群管理能力已由平台托管。它介于纯基础设施和纯平台服务之间,更像是一种向PaaS演进的现代云平台能力。
再看函数计算。开发者上传代码后,系统自动处理实例启动、弹性伸缩、请求调度、部分监控和可用性保障。此时用户几乎不再关心“服务器在哪里”,这比传统PaaS还要更进一步。也正因如此,今天再问阿里云是iaas还是paas,本质上是在用一个相对传统的二分法,去解释一个已经高度融合的云服务体系。
企业为什么总想搞清楚这个问题
这个问题并不只是概念之争,它直接影响企业的采购决策和技术架构。如果你把阿里云简单理解成IaaS,就可能在很多明明可以托管的场景里,仍然坚持自建数据库、自建缓存、自建消息队列,结果导致运维负担过重;反过来,如果你把所有服务都当成PaaS,忽略了某些底层资源的性能、网络隔离和安全合规要求,也可能在关键业务上踩坑。
例如金融、政务、制造等行业,很多核心系统对网络拓扑、权限边界、部署方式和审计机制要求极高,这类场景通常更重视IaaS层的可控性;而电商、内容平台、互联网创新业务则更希望快速上线、快速迭代,因此更愿意采用RDS、容器服务、消息队列、函数计算等PaaS化能力,提高研发效率与弹性能力。
最终结论:阿里云不是“二选一”,而是“分层能力集合”
所以,回到文章开头的问题,阿里云是iaas还是paas?最准确的答案是:阿里云首先是一家综合云服务平台,其中既有典型IaaS产品,也有成熟PaaS产品,用户最终感受到的是一种按需组合的云能力。如果你购买ECS、VPC、OSS,使用感知会更偏向IaaS;如果你大量采用RDS、ACK、函数计算、消息服务等,则会更明显地体验到PaaS甚至更高级云原生服务的价值。
对于企业来说,真正重要的并不是执着于给阿里云贴一个单一标签,而是搞清楚自己的业务到底需要哪一层服务。技术团队强、定制需求高、合规要求严,可以多用IaaS;希望缩短交付周期、降低运维成本、提高创新速度,则应更多采用PaaS。聪明的架构通常不是只选一种,而是把IaaS的可控性与PaaS的效率结合起来,找到最适合自身业务的平衡点。
说到底,阿里云之所以能在企业市场中被广泛采用,恰恰不是因为它只属于IaaS或PaaS中的某一类,而是因为它能覆盖从底层资源到上层平台的完整路径。理解这一点,才算真正把“阿里云到底是什么”这件事讲清楚了。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/174493.html